## Authentication

Heads up: the nightly reindex job (`reindex_nightly.py`) talks to the Lanternfish search cluster, and that cluster won't accept anonymous writes anymore — we locked it down last sprint. The job now authenticates as the `reindex-runner` service identity against Corvid Gateway, and the token is injected via the `LF_INDEX_TOKEN` env var in the scheduler config. Nothing clever going on, just a bearer header on every batch request. For review purposes, the staging credential currently in use is listed below.

service key, kadug-kadup: kto15_rN23XLAYImmZgrJ

Subject: Cut-over complete — Brindlewick health checks

Hi on-call,

We finished the Brindlewick cut-over at 02:10. The load balancer now probes /healthz on the new pool; old nodes stay registered but drained until Friday. Watch for flapping if probe latency exceeds the 2s timeout — that bit us in staging. Escalate to the platform channel if more than two nodes go unhealthy at once. The current service configuration values are listed below for reference.

deployment values, bahof-badug:
[rusix]
team = zorok
access_code = ac_641cbe
owner = ulair.tamius
host = rusix.torvasoft.local
port = 5672
peer = ulaix.sivrelworks.internal
salt = 1df570ed
pin = 6327

Handover note — Crumbwheel order cutoffs.

Welcome aboard. The bakery cutoff rule in Crumbwheel closes same-day orders at 14:00 local to each storefront, not UTC — this has bitten us twice. Holiday overrides live in the calendar service and take precedence silently, so always check there first when a cutoff looks wrong. To unlock the calendar service's admin console after a restart, enter the recovery passphrase below.

vault phrase of bagap-bahaf = silion-pelox-sorox-casdor-quenwyn-fraax-eliox-praael-kelion-quenvan-kasox-rusael-norius-belvan

Ticket #412 — PickPath vault locked. The optimizer config vault for PickPath (warehouse pick-list sequencing at Drossel Fulfillment) auto-locked after three failed token renewals. Until unlocked, route weights fall back to defaults and pick times degrade roughly 12%. Future maintainers: do not recreate the vault; historical weight snapshots live inside it. Unlock through the vault CLI on the batch host. When the CLI asks, enter the recovery passphrase below.

recovery phrase for fajep-yaweg: gilath-sorox-wenius-rusdor-keliel-zorius